The climate of South Australia's Langhorne Creek is perfect for the production of rich reds, like this juicy Shiraz, which has a splash of Mourvèdre added for extra grunt.
Youthful dark red. Sweet red and blue fruit with hints of dried herb and charcuterie. Medium to full-bodied, with juicy cherry and plum fruit depth, subtle vanillin oak, cocoa-like tannins, and an earthy note on the long finish.
